Raising the Bar

Someone call the posh police: bottle service has hit the ’hood By Courtney Shea



Image credit: Ryan Szulc

Concept: The latest addition to the ever-swelling Queen West West strip is sandwiched somewhere between the Drake and the Cadillac Lounge, both literally and figuratively. Not quite as hip as the former nor as honky-tonk as the latter, the loungy space is still the ritziest stop west of Dufferin. This isn’t exactly good news for the diehard anti-gentrification crowd, but owner Catherine Thai, whose mother, Rose, runs the nearby Saigon Flower, spent close to two years renovating this former pool hall on the hunch that Parkdalers were ready for a little swank with their sauce.

Crowd: The typical west-end mix of high fashion and unkempt facial hair—i.e., the “I’m with the band” aesthetic. Friends linger over nightcaps by the bar, while couples cozy up in leather armchairs near the front; local DJs spin rock, house, R&B and Top 40 on Friday and Saturday nights.

Cocktails: Everything from premium vodka to trendy Patrón tequila to fruity Alizé can be bought in bulk. For those seeking a single libation, the eponymous signature concoction combines Jack Daniel’s, vodka, pomegranate liqueur and Sprite. A bold choice, perhaps—but so is a martini lounge in Parkdale.

The Parkdale Drink, 1292 Queen St. W., 416-778-8822. Monday 5 p.m.–midnight, Wednesday 5 p.m.–1 a.m., Thursday and Friday 5 p.m.–2 a.m., Saturday 11 a.m.–2 a.m., Sunday 11 a.m.–1 a.m.
